What is on an Engineer's Mind?
Engineering, as we do it at IBT, is a challenging and rewarding job. We are never sure what each day, each project, each new piece of input will do.

We must come to each job and work each day with the dynamics of a mindset that is:

  • Focused: Look closely at the task at hand.
  • Curious: What do I need to think about? What do I need to know?
  • Paranoid: What hasn't the customer told me?
  • Creatively negative: What could go wrong? How do I prevent it?
  • Inquisitive: Let me ask you another question…
  • Knowledgeable: One horsepower equals 745.7 watts. a˛ + b˛ = c˛
  • Experienced: I think I remember a job similar to this from last year.
  • Flexible: There are many ways to skin the proverbial cat.
  • Collegial: I wonder what the project supervisor thinks about this?
  • Patient: Let's go slowly – and get all the facts right.
  • Persistent: Let's do those calcs again, just to make sure they're right.
  • Determined: This is going to be the best system they've ever seen.
